Understanding and Using the Lidocaine Dose Calculator

The Lidocaine Dose Calculator is a helpful tool designed to determine the correct dosage of lidocaine for patient treatment. Lidocaine is a common local anesthetic used in various medical procedures, and administering the right amount is crucial for patient safety and efficacy. This calculator assists healthcare providers in calculating the maximum safe dose and volume of lidocaine that can be administered.

Deriving the Answer

The calculator uses the patient’s weight and converts it to kilograms if needed. It then multiplies the weight by the maximum safe dose to determine the total safe dose. The concentration of lidocaine, indicated in percentage, is converted to mg/mL. Finally, the maximum safe dose in milligrams is divided by this concentration to get the maximum volume in milliliters. This ensures the dosage is within safe limits based on the provided inputs.

What is Lidocaine?

Lidocaine is a local anesthetic used to numb specific areas of the body during medical procedures. It works by blocking nerve signals in the body, providing pain relief.

Why is accurate lidocaine dosing important?

Precise dosing of lidocaine is essential to avoid both underdosing, which could result in insufficient pain relief, and overdosing, which could lead to serious side effects such as toxic reactions or cardiovascular issues.

What factors determine the dosage of lidocaine?

The dosage of lidocaine is influenced by several factors including the patient’s weight, the concentration of lidocaine being used, and whether it is administered with or without epinephrine.

How is the maximum safe dose of lidocaine calculated?

The maximum safe dose is calculated by multiplying the patient’s weight in kilograms by the maximum allowed dose of lidocaine in mg/kg. This value varies based on whether the administration involves epinephrine.

What is the importance of lidocaine concentration?

The concentration of lidocaine, usually indicated as a percentage, determines the amount of lidocaine present per milliliter of solution. This concentration helps calculate the maximum volume of lidocaine that can be safely administered.

What is the difference between using lidocaine with and without epinephrine?

Lidocaine with epinephrine allows for a higher maximum safe dose because epinephrine constricts blood vessels, reducing the absorption rate and prolonging the anesthetic effect. Without epinephrine, the maximum safe dose is lower.

How do I convert lidocaine concentration from percentage to mg/mL?

To convert the concentration from percentage to mg/mL, multiply the percentage value by 10. For example, a 2% lidocaine solution contains 20 mg of lidocaine per 1 mL of solution.
